What Su Miao said was indeed correct. The Guangxi region attached great importance to the prevention and treatment of thalassemia.

In the years that followed, relevant departments invested a lot of manpower, material and financial resources, and gradually established a complete prenatal screening and treatment system.

Since 2019, Gui District has promoted free thalassemia screening, free genetic diagnosis and free prenatal diagnosis.

Thalassemia hemoglobin analysis and rescreening and fetal medical intervention for severe thalassemia will be included in the scope of free services.

Provide "five free services" for people who are married and have children, implement a policy of free services throughout the entire process to benefit the people, and achieve full coverage of the policy.

After decades of unremitting efforts by two generations, birth defects have been reduced, the birth of fetuses with severe thalassemia has been avoided, the quality of life of patients has been improved and even cured, which has greatly reduced the huge burden on families and society and achieved remarkable results.
